Tuxtla Gutiérrez, Chis., In the almost two years of administration of the federal government there is a 64 percent decrease in the daily average of malicious homicides in Chiapas, going from 2.5 to 0.9, reported the head of the Executive Secretariat of the National Public Security System, Marcela Figueroa.
